The hospitality industry in Minneapolis is built on the foundation of exceptional guest service. However, even the most highly rated hotels face a unique challenge when it comes to providing late-night food and beverage options. When the on-site restaurant closes the kitchen and the room service staff clocks out for the night, guests are often left with very few convenient choices. For a weary traveler arriving on a delayed flight or a family returning from a late concert downtown, the ability to find a quick and reliable snack is a crucial component of their overall experience. A strategically placed vending machine in a hotel lobby, near the ice machines, or on key guest floors serves as a vital 24-hour micro-amenity. In a dynamic city like Minneapolis, hotel guests operate on all sorts of unpredictable schedules. Having a SnackDock Vending machine available means they do not have to navigate unfamiliar streets at midnight or pay exorbitant delivery fees for a simple bottle of water or a bag of chips. This level of immediate convenience is frequently highlighted in positive guest reviews. In the competitive world of hospitality, anticipating and meeting these basic needs is exactly what drives repeat bookings and builds brand loyalty.
